Understanding the Connection Between HPV and Prostate Cancer Prostate cancer is a significant health concern for men worldwide, and recent research has shed light on a potential contributing factor: the Human Papillomavirus (HPV). While HPV is widely known for its link to cervical cancer in women, emerging evidence suggests it may also play a role in the development of prostate cancer. This blog post delves into the current understanding of this connection, exploring the research, potential mechanisms, and preventive measures. What is HPV? Human Papillomavirus (HPV) is a common virus that is primarily spread through skin-to-skin contact. There are over 100 types of HPV, with some causing warts and others being associated with various cancers. It is the most common sexually transmitted infection (STI) globally. While many HPV infections are cleared by the body's immune system without causing any health problems, persistent infections with certain high-risk HPV types can lead to cellular changes that may eventually develop into cancer. What is Prostate Cancer? Prostate cancer occurs when abnormal cells grow uncontrollably in the prostate gland, a small gland in men located below the bladder and in front of the rectum. The prostate produces fluid that nourishes and transports sperm. Prostate cancer often grows slowly and may not cause symptoms in its early stages. However, if left untreated, it can spread to other parts of the body, becoming more aggressive and difficult to manage. The Link Between HPV and Prostate Cancer: What Research Says Several studies have investigated the potential relationship between HPV infection and an increased risk of prostate cancer. Some research suggests a causal connection , meaning that HPV infection could be a direct cause of cancerous cell development in the prostate. This process is similar to how HPV is believed to cause cervical cancer. The proposed mechanism involves inflammation. An HPV infection in the prostate can lead to chronic inflammation. This inflammation, in turn, can increase the risk of benign prostatic hyperplasia (BPH), a non-cancerous enlargement of the prostate gland. In some cases, the persistent inflammation caused by HPV may contribute to the transformation of these benign growths into cancerous tissue. A review of studies in 2017 supported the idea that HPV plays a role in prostate cancer. More recently, a 2021 study highlighted the involvement of ApoB and an enzyme called A3B. Elevated levels of A3B can accelerate prostate cell production and increase the risk of cancerous tumor cell formation. This further strengthens the hypothesis that viral infections like HPV can influence the cellular processes leading to prostate cancer. Other Cancers Linked to HPV It's important to note that HPV is not only linked to prostate cancer but also to other cancers in men and individuals assigned male at birth. These include: Anal cancer Penile cancer Oropharyngeal cancer (cancers of the back of the throat, including the base of the tongue and tonsils) Cancers of the head and neck Understanding these broader associations underscores the importance of HPV prevention. Risk Factors for Prostate Cancer While HPV may be a contributing factor, it's crucial to remember that prostate cancer is a complex disease with multiple risk factors. These include: Age: The risk of prostate cancer increases significantly with age, particularly after 50. Family History: Having a father or brother with prostate cancer more than doubles your risk. Race/Ethnicity: African American men have a higher risk of developing prostate cancer and are more likely to have aggressive forms of the disease. Obesity: Being overweight or obese may increase the risk of more aggressive prostate cancer. Diet: Diets high in red meat and high-fat dairy products have been linked to an increased risk. Lifestyle factors: While not definitively proven, factors like smoking and lack of physical activity may also play a role. Can the HPV Vaccine Prevent Prostate Cancer? The HPV vaccine is highly effective in preventing infections with the HPV types that cause most cancers. While the vaccine does not directly prevent prostate cancer , it can significantly lower the risk of HPV infection , which is a potential contributing factor. By preventing HPV infections, the vaccine indirectly reduces the risk associated with HPV-related prostate cancer. Therefore, vaccination is a crucial step in reducing the overall burden of HPV-related diseases, including potentially prostate cancer. The COVID-19 pandemic has also had an indirect impact. Reduced access to healthcare and vaccination services during the pandemic may have led to lower HPV vaccination rates, potentially increasing the long-term risk of HPV-related cancers, including prostate cancer, for those who might have been protected by the vaccine. Diagnosis of Prostate Cancer Diagnosing prostate cancer typically involves several steps: Digital Rectal Exam (DRE): A doctor manually checks the prostate for abnormalities. Prostate-Specific Antigen (PSA) Blood Test: This test measures the level of PSA, a protein produced by the prostate. Elevated levels can indicate prostate cancer, but also other conditions like BPH or prostatitis. Biopsy: If DRE or PSA tests are abnormal, a biopsy is performed to obtain tissue samples for microscopic examination to confirm the presence and type of cancer. Imaging Tests: MRI, CT scans, or bone scans may be used to determine the extent of the cancer and whether it has spread.
